在现代网络环境中,虚拟私人网络(VPN)已成为保障远程访问安全、实现跨地域通信和保护数据隐私的重要工具,无论是企业用户还是个人用户,合理配置并理解VPN配置描述文件(Configuration File)是成功部署和维护VPN连接的关键一步,本文将系统性地介绍VPN配置描述文件的结构、常见格式、典型应用场景以及配置优化技巧,帮助网络工程师高效管理各类VPN服务。

什么是VPN配置描述文件?它是一种包含连接参数的文本文件,用于指导客户端或服务器如何建立和管理VPN会话,常见的格式包括OpenVPN的.ovpn文件、Cisco AnyConnect的.xml配置文件、以及Windows内置的PPTP/L2TP/IPsec配置模板等,这些文件通常以纯文本形式存在,可由文本编辑器打开和修改,但需要严格遵循语法规范,否则会导致连接失败或安全漏洞。

一个典型的OpenVPN配置文件示例包含以下核心段落:

  • remote server.example.com 1194:指定服务器地址和端口号;
  • proto udp:定义传输协议(UDP更适用于高延迟环境);
  • dev tun:声明虚拟设备类型(tun表示三层隧道,tap表示二层);
  • ca ca.crtcert client.crtkey client.key:引用证书与密钥文件,用于身份认证;
  • auth-user-pass:启用用户名密码认证;
  • tls-auth ta.key 1:使用TLS密钥增强安全性;
  • cipher AES-256-CBC:设置加密算法,提升数据保密性。

这些配置项共同构建了一个完整的连接策略,值得注意的是,不同厂商的设备(如华为、思科、Fortinet)可能使用不同的配置语法,因此在实际部署中需参考对应厂商文档进行适配。

在企业级场景中,配置描述文件常被用于批量部署,IT部门可以为员工提供统一的.ovpn文件,只需导入即可快速接入公司内网,这不仅节省了手动配置的时间,也降低了人为错误风险,通过脚本自动化处理配置文件(如Python读取CSV生成多个客户端配置),可进一步提高运维效率。

对于高级用户而言,还可以对配置文件进行深度定制,比如添加路由规则(route 192.168.10.0 255.255.255.0)实现特定子网访问;启用压缩功能(comp-lzo)减少带宽消耗;或者设置心跳包频率(keepalive 10 120)避免因长时间无数据传输导致连接中断。

安全始终是首要考虑因素,建议定期更新证书、禁用弱加密算法(如RC4)、使用强密码策略,并对配置文件进行权限控制(仅限管理员访问),应避免在配置文件中明文存储敏感信息,可采用环境变量或外部密钥管理服务(如HashiCorp Vault)来增强安全性。

掌握VPN配置描述文件不仅是网络工程师的基本技能,更是实现安全、高效远程办公的基础,随着零信任架构和SD-WAN技术的发展,未来对灵活、可编程的配置管理需求将日益增长,深入理解配置文件的每一个字段及其作用,将成为提升网络服务质量的核心竞争力。

深入解析VPN配置描述文件,从基础到高级应用指南  第1张

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N